A Postgraduate Certificate in Organic Food Exporting provides specialized training for professionals seeking to navigate the complexities of the global organic food market. This intensive program equips participants with the practical skills and theoretical knowledge necessary to succeed in this dynamic sector.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of organic food certification standards (such as USDA Organic and EU Organic), international trade regulations, and effective export strategies. Students develop proficiency in market analysis, supply chain management, and the logistics of exporting perishable goods, including safe and sustainable transportation methods.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Organic Food Exporting program varies, but it usually spans between six months and one year, depending on the institution and the intensity of the coursework. Many programs offer flexible online learning options alongside in-person components, catering to working professionals.

A Postgraduate Certificate in Organic Food Exporting is increasingly significant in today's market, driven by burgeoning global demand for organic products. The UK organic food and drink market is thriving; the market value was estimated at £2.9 billion in 2022, a testament to rising consumer consciousness. This growth presents substantial export opportunities for UK businesses.
Understanding the complexities of exporting organic food, including certifications (e.g., Soil Association), regulations, and international trade agreements, is crucial for success.
